Seriously I wondered how Alan felt when viewing that video. Was he insulted or did he shrug n laugh? At the time it is said that Alan wasn't too chuffed. The story goes that he would walk out the room if that video came on the TV or whatever. To be fair to Alan it seems he was given very short notice to return to Blighty for the video as the Record Company were suddenly aware that they had a hit on their hands and wanting to maximise the exposure. He couldn't or wouldn't fly over at such short notice. Indecent exposure in Alan's mind I suspect with the resulting video! Colin Johnson's idea apparently in the circumstances and the Master Puppeteer. Must have been a funny sight with Colin and Rick driving around London/Soho with the dummy in the car. Think they were pulled over by the Local Constabulary...
